- Your role will be focused on Software Engineering in Malvern, Worcestershire.
- You will be given 20% of your working week to cover University commitments as you work towards a degree.
- You will undertake a variety of tasks across the whole of the software lifecycle, ensuring technical solutions meet business and customer requirements.
- We have many interesting and sometimes cutting edge domains in which you will work alongside domain experts.
- You will have the opportunity to work in Hybrid manner (Office / Home working) although may be dependent on the project you are allocated too.
- You may be asked to travel to other QinetiQ sites / Customer sites to support training, meetings or trials.
- You'll be trained in a wide range of programming tools, methods and techniques, allowing you to add value to your organisation straight away.
- The apprenticeship will help you develop the practical skills and theoretical knowledge you need for a career in the IT sector.
- The course covers applied competence in the application of IT, promotes business awareness and delivers understanding of the issues central to IT organisations.
